Located in the Clear Creek Independent School District at 2401 E Meyer Rd in Seabrook, TX, Seabrook Intermediate School serves grades 6-8 and has an enrollment of roughly 1000 students. Frequently Asked Questions about Seabrook
How much are Studio apartments in Seabrook?
There are currently 1 Studio Apartments in Seabrook with rent ranges from $799 to $875 with an average price of $843.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Seabrook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Seabrook ranges from $540 to $2,779 with an average monthly rent of $1,338.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Seabrook c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Seabrook range from $1,100 to $3,815.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,760.
How expensive are Seabrook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 12 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Seabrook on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,400 to $4,994 - averaging $2,567 for the location.
